How to set up a outdoor event.

Most events won’t be complete without a stage or platform regardless of the situation, the main objective is to meet the audience expectation and set the mood for a successful event. This includes location, stage design, lighting or backdrops. These all play a crucial role in setting the perfect mood for the event, but not all two events are the same.

Basics of Outdoor staging


No matter how detailed or expensive the stage plan is, the key focal point for setting up an event is audience appeal of the stage. There are three crucial elements that make up a successful event.


Stage Design


Stage designers are able to create stage venues with the clients initial input in association with the overall event type to make a successful event. While focusing on visually appealing stage design to attract the audience attention throughout the event.


Lighting Equipment


Professional stage lighting is key to a stage design, it is fundamental to have the proper lighting accessories to set the mood for the event. While some equipment rental companies may provide the lighting system that can make an event special, it also has a lot to do with lighting control.


Backdrop and stage set


A stage set is simple, it is where all event formalities happen. An event with a plain stage can be a bore, this is why backdrops like banners, video projections or event names are displayed. These elements are used to bring the focus to the stage and emphasize the importance of this event.
